After 10+ yrs driving modern 911 as my DD, I made the switch to Mercedes again.
Overall very impressed with the machine! It's bi-polar to say the least.
The car it's getting loose after 1k miles and I've a few questions:
Anyone experiencing or experienced Satellite radio issues? Mine is horrible, I keep losing the signal. Going back to the shop next week, they did an update to the radio at the dealer and a master reset at Sirius last week. A small improvement but still loosing the signal.
Ventilated seats? Are they that weak? I can't barely feel the seats ventilating. Any thoughts?
K & N air filters? I ran them on my Porsche's in the past. No issues. Anyone using them on the SL? Any noticeable difference? Sound improvement?
How do I replace the paper ones? I couldn't see any screws to remove the filter housing.
Any input would be appreciated. Thanks in advance.

Sat radio was an antenna issue; replaced and fixed.
The ventilated seats are a joke; I'll look through the forum...........K&N is a gimmick...sound, more than anything else.
Great car overall, impressive. I'm still trying to get used to the slight hesitation of the transmission. Been driving manuals for too long.
